Logo by stereoman - Contribute your own Logo!

END OF AN ERA, FRACTALFORUMS.COM IS CONTINUED ON FRACTALFORUMS.ORG

it was a great time but no longer maintainable by c.Kleinhuis contact him for any data retrieval,
thanks and see you perhaps in 10 years again

this forum will stay online for reference
News: Visit us on facebook
 
*
Welcome, Guest. Please login or register. April 17, 2024, 01:21:13 AM


Login with username, password and session length


The All New FractalForums is now in Public Beta Testing! Visit FractalForums.org and check it out!


Pages: [1] 2   Go Down
  Print  
Share this topic on DiggShare this topic on FacebookShare this topic on GoogleShare this topic on RedditShare this topic on StumbleUponShare this topic on Twitter
Author Topic: Mandelbulber v2 - 2.10  (Read 8729 times)
0 Members and 1 Guest are viewing this topic.
Buddhi
Fractal Iambus
***
Posts: 895



WWW
« on: February 22, 2017, 06:44:47 PM »

Mandelbulber v2 2.10

Free download (executables for win32 and win64): http://sourceforge.net/projects/mandelbulber/
https://github.com/buddhi1980/mandelbulber2

Together with zebastian, mclarekin, bermarte and mancoast we have finished new version of Mandelbulber.
Development of this release was focused on implementation of "Anim by Sound" functionality. There is possible to animate fractal parameters and effects using sound wave together with keyframe control.
Another interesting feature is direct export 3D mesh to *.ply file which can be imported in Blender.
Additionally there was a lot of actions to improve program stability and to implement many small improvements.


What is new?
v2.10
- AnimBySound: Added option to animate any parameter using sound wave (added "Anim By Sound" buttons in animation table)
- AnimBySound: Added dialog window to load and setup AnimBySound feature
- AnimBySound: Added views for waveform, fft and animation generated from sound
- AnimBySound: It is possible to load wav, ogg, flac (all operating systems) and mp3 (Linux only)
- AnimBySound: Added binary, decay and smooth filters for animation generated from sound
- AnimBySound: Added sound player
- Settings: added description field for fractal settings
- Settings: fixed bug: there was not possible to load settings saved with CR+LF line terminations
- Settings: material #1 was not saved properly to settings file when was previously loaded using "Load material..." option.
- Added new fractal formulas:
  * Menger - Prism Shape2
  * MixPinski 4D
  * Sierpinski 3D
  * Sierpinski 4D
  * Menger 4D
  * Menger 4D Mod1
  * Menger - Smooth
  * Menger - Smooth Mod1
  * Menger - Octo
  * Abox 4D
  * Transform - SurfBoxFold
  * Transform - Octo Fold
  * Transform - ScaleVaryVCL
  * Transform - Spherical_Fold_VaryVCL
  * Transform - Add exp2(z)
  * Transform - Reciprocal3
  * Transform - Reciprocal 4D
  * Transform - Rotated Folding
  * Transform - FabsAddConditional
  * Transform - Reciprocal 4D
  * Transform - FabsAddConditional 4D
  * Transform - Spherical_OffsetVCL
  * Transform - Rotation 4D
- Fractals: Various updates, fixes and enhancements to existing formulas and transforms
- Fractals: fixed bug: after swapping of formula slots, the Mandelbulb formula appeared on random slots.
- German translation for all formula UIs
- Shaders: in some cases there was wrong calculation of object colors in boolean mode
- Shaders: fixed bug in DOF algorithm which could cause crashes
- Animation: Improved gamepad integration for flight animations
- Animation: Added image with gamepad keymap (tooltip)
- Animation: there is displayed correct message when first frame was equal to last frame
- Animation: increased maximum value in frames per keyframe spinbox to 10000
- Animation: fixed bug: there was possible to get different interpolation type (random one) for each frame
- Animation: fixed bug: check for collision showed false messages even if errors were already corrected
- Materials/Animation: fixed bug: program crashed with animation, when there was an added parameter from material which was previously loaded using "Load material" button
- Materials/Animation: fixed bug: program crashed with animation, when there was an added parameter from material which was previously edited using dialog called by Edit Material button
- UI: Image quality settings added to file selector for images
- UI: Corrected resolution lock function
- UI: auto-refresh is now disabled when brightness, gamma, contrast or HDR is changed
- UI: added information in fractal formula information box about examples which use the formula
- UI: changed and added more keyboard shortcuts for camera navigation
- UI: fixed bug: When the group box of primitives was saved and then loaded the group was always enabled
- UI: when dark theme is used then text color in animation table is always black
- UI: added Dutch language
- UI: added options to store/restore different layouts (states) of docks
- UI: navigation dock is locked when flight is being recorded
- UI: fixed bug: When boolean mode was selected, the displayed DE type was displayed as "DE unknown"
- UI: fixed bug: Refreshing of DOF and image adjustments now is blocked during rendering of image
- Voxel export: added automatic calculation of bounding box
- Voxel export: Added ability to export 3D meshes in *.ply format
- General: changed data folder from .mandelbulber (hidden) to mandelbulber (not hidden)
- General: changed default folder for animation frames to ~/mandelbulber/animation
- General: fixed bug: Wrong file names when contained dot
- CLI: added stdin input for CLI arguments
- CLI: added --benchmark option which calculates total time needed to render all examples in low resolution
- Performance: fixed several memory leaks
- Performance: eliminated crash reason: added Added QMutexLocker() to all getters and setters for in cParameterContainer class.
- Performance: Animation player widget caused crashes when frames were deleted from image folder
- Documentation: Added help menu with user manual (beta version)
- Examples: Added many example settings with most of new formulas.
- Compilation: main window UI file divided onto several smaller UIs, this has improved compilation performance
- Compilation: used a lot of forward declarations to reduce compilation time
- Compilation: code is now fully compatible with msvc
- Compilation: created solution file for msvc14 with all needed NuGet packages
- Compilation: configured Appveyor to test msvc++ builds
- Compilation: a lot of cleaning up of the code
- Compilation: much improved populateUiInformation.php script
- Compilation: added export CXXFLAGS="-march=native to install script

As always every feedback is appreciated!

Source code repository (GIT, SVN) https://github.com/buddhi1980/mandelbulber2

<a href="http://www.youtube.com/v/4YArbdU4dYU&rel=1&fs=1&hd=1" target="_blank">http://www.youtube.com/v/4YArbdU4dYU&rel=1&fs=1&hd=1</a>
Logged

Snicker02
Alien
***
Posts: 38


« Reply #1 on: February 22, 2017, 06:54:08 PM »

TOTALLY COOL!!!! cheesy  afro  cheesy
Logged
DarkBeam
Global Moderator
Fractal Senior
******
Posts: 2512


Fragments of the fractal -like the tip of it


« Reply #2 on: February 22, 2017, 10:45:59 PM »

Mega yays to developers and especially Maclarekin!!! sweet music surprised
Logged

No sweat, guardian of wisdom!
LMarkoya
Strange Attractor
***
Posts: 282



« Reply #3 on: February 23, 2017, 01:00:20 AM »

Thank you for your continued work and enthusiasm
Logged
Snicker02
Alien
***
Posts: 38


« Reply #4 on: February 23, 2017, 01:30:59 AM »

Created with Mandelbubler .... sound synced fractal cheesy
<a href="http://www.youtube.com/v/AEGJqsuTnBI&rel=1&fs=1&hd=1" target="_blank">http://www.youtube.com/v/AEGJqsuTnBI&rel=1&fs=1&hd=1</a>
music used from http://ccmixter.org/files/sackjo22/21492
Logged
freakiebeat
Forums Freshman
**
Posts: 16


WWW
« Reply #5 on: February 25, 2017, 01:22:44 AM »

Super stoked!! There goes any free time I thought I might have had.
Logged

A Flame A Day Keeps Psychosis Away - http://bit.ly/my247sheep
mclarekin
Fractal Senior
******
Posts: 1739



« Reply #6 on: February 26, 2017, 08:17:57 AM »

Here are some examples using Menger4D formula.

Note: These examples do not use the  Spherical Fold on the Menger4D UI, because it is broken, will be fixed later.

The Initial Value of z.w parameter is currently located in the fractal  - global parameters tab

* menger4.zip (10.61 KB - downloaded 102 times.)
Logged
taurus
Fractal Supremo
*****
Posts: 1175



profile.php?id=1339106810 @taurus_arts_66
WWW
« Reply #7 on: February 27, 2017, 12:26:53 AM »

Thanks for the effort guys. As usual, I'll start testing the new features with a little delay, but the audio animation will hopefully matter for the next movie. For now, Iam working out the a_surf hybrid, v2.09 refused to animate beyond the first frame. Works fine in v2.10 - intended or unintended. Keep it up!  A Beer Cup
Btw It seems Jos and knighty's kleinian toy didn't make it to the formula list or did I get something wrong?
« Last Edit: February 27, 2017, 12:38:37 AM by taurus » Logged

when life offers you a lemon, get yourself some salt and tequila!
mfg
Explorer
****
Posts: 41



WWW
« Reply #8 on: March 01, 2017, 03:54:42 AM »

Hello mclarekin and colleagues,

Thank you for your reply.
I am trying to setup the new version but cannot meet qt dependencies. (kubuntu16.10)
Downloaded the file to prepare ubuntu for development, however I get the following error:

sudo sh ./prepare_for_dev_ubuntu.sh
./prepare_for_dev_ubuntu.sh: 8: ./prepare_for_dev_ubuntu.sh: Syntax error: newline unexpected

your help will be much appreciated,
Logged
mfg
Explorer
****
Posts: 41



WWW
« Reply #9 on: March 01, 2017, 04:29:38 AM »

Installed the dependencies from the readme in deploy folder and this way met dependencies. So I have compiled ok!
Logged
mfg
Explorer
****
Posts: 41



WWW
« Reply #10 on: March 01, 2017, 06:44:21 AM »

Yes, I can now save long filenames with dots in between. Good job!

Your work is extraordinary.
Stereo renderings are superb

congratulations!


* c2iE-1+2-3D(0;-.8,.2)(10;-17,4)2000x1125st.1fv.26cdt13.jpg (193.43 KB, 2000x1125 - viewed 265 times.)
Logged
mclarekin
Fractal Senior
******
Posts: 1739



« Reply #11 on: March 02, 2017, 08:12:05 AM »

Quote
It seems Jos and knighty's kleinian toy didn't make it to the formula list
@ taurus
I have yet to code it. Hopefully by  next release, it looks cool


Quote
So I have compiled ok!
@ mfg

cool  smiley
Logged
joe
Explorer
****
Posts: 47


« Reply #12 on: March 04, 2017, 05:09:27 AM »

Anim by sound. My prayers are answered again! My first music video thingy is on the way. The wave file interface is really quite sophisticated, I'm impressed. It only took a bit of tinkering to understand the different functions, it might help if the output graph showed the value of what was going into the parameter. Showing a value with mouse hover, and zoom in to wave and graph would make it really powerful for calibration.

I use Resolume Arena a lot, it has audio reactive control of parameters too. You can set a parameter to move relative or inverse to the audio band intensity, or you can set parameter to play through via intensity of sound. So when an audio band is louder, the parameter progresses faster. This works very well with loopable parameters like rotation, so the sound is driving the parameter round and round. At the moment I just use Resolume to audio-loop a video with one animated parameter and it is super effective. Being able to loop with many parameters would be next level trippy tho.

I am going to make a lot of music videos. This is going to be really fun.
Oh I got a GTX1070 for when gpu rendering comes along :-)
Logged
mclarekin
Fractal Senior
******
Posts: 1739



« Reply #13 on: March 04, 2017, 07:56:21 AM »

@ Joe. Thanks for checking it out. BTW there is a new section in the  manual covering the basics of Anim by Audio, accessed through the Help menu.

The current layout, functionality and other enhancements are being evaluated, like an output graph showing the animVal (rather than having to estimate it in my head.)

Quote
So when an audio band is louder, the parameter progresses faster.

Yep, there are lots of different responses to the digital audio data to explore, it will be fun.
Logged
mclarekin
Fractal Senior
******
Posts: 1739



« Reply #14 on: March 05, 2017, 12:17:20 PM »

Here is a zip of mainly prismshape2 examples from V2.10

* prismshape2.zip (40.94 KB - downloaded 113 times.)
Logged
Pages: [1] 2   Go Down
  Print  
 
Jump to:  

Related Topics
Subject Started by Replies Views Last post
Mandelbulber 0.80 Mandelbulber Buddhi 5 8185 Last post June 27, 2010, 05:30:54 PM
by knighty
Mandelbulber 0.85 Mandelbulber Buddhi 6 4925 Last post July 25, 2010, 10:00:13 PM
by kram1032
Mandelbulber 0.93 Mandelbulber Buddhi 12 6300 Last post October 17, 2010, 03:19:15 PM
by Buddhi
mandelbulber Help & Support ramblerette 1 1038 Last post October 18, 2010, 02:56:02 PM
by ramblerette
Mandelbulber 0.94 Mandelbulber « 1 2 » Buddhi 15 10456 Last post October 24, 2010, 09:36:01 AM
by Buddhi

Powered by MySQL Powered by PHP Powered by SMF 1.1.21 | SMF © 2015, Simple Machines

Valid XHTML 1.0! Valid CSS! Dilber MC Theme by HarzeM
Page created in 0.156 seconds with 26 queries. (Pretty URLs adds 0.01s, 2q)